On 2017/6/14 19:25, John Stultz wrote:
> Add entry for k3-dma driver and i2s/hdmi audio devices.
> 
> This enables HDMI audio output.
> 
> Cc: Zhangfei Gao <zhangfei.gao@linaro.org>
> Cc: Liam Girdwood <lgirdwood@gmail.com>
> Cc: Mark Brown <broonie@kernel.org>
> Cc: Jaroslav Kysela <perex@perex.cz>
> Cc: Takashi Iwai <tiwai@suse.com>
> Cc: Wei Xu <xuwei5@hisilicon.com>
> Cc: Rob Herring <robh+dt@kernel.org>
> Cc: Andy Green <andy@warmcat.com>
> Cc: Dave Long <dave.long@linaro.org>
> Cc: Guodong Xu <guodong.xu@linaro.org>
> Cc: Antonio Borneo <borneo.antonio@gmail.com>
> Cc: Olof Johansson <olof@lixom.net>
> Cc: Arnd Bergmann <arnd@arndb.de>
> Signed-off-by: John Stultz <john.stultz@linaro.org>
> v2:
> * Split core i2s entry into dtsi and hdmi specific bits into
>   hikey dts
> v4:
> * Rework simple-card to use many-dai-links method, as
>   there may be other links in the future
> v5:
> * Rework audio description to use the audio-card-graph method
>   as requested by Mark.

>  arch/arm64/boot/dts/hisilicon/hi6220-hikey.dts | 34 +++++++++++++++++++++++---
>  arch/arm64/boot/dts/hisilicon/hi6220.dtsi      | 26 ++++++++++++++++++++
>  2 files changed, 57 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
> 
> diff --git a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/hisilicon/hi6220-hikey.dts b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/hisilicon/hi6220-hikey.dts
> index 5cdfe73..2b52630 100644
> --- a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/hisilicon/hi6220-hikey.dts
> +++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/hisilicon/hi6220-hikey.dts
> @@ -468,6 +468,11 @@
>  			method = "smc";
>  		};
>  	};
> +
> +	sound_card {
> +		compatible = "audio-graph-card";
> +		dais = <&i2s0_port0>;
> +	};
>  };
>  
>  &uart2 {
> @@ -508,10 +513,33 @@
>  		interrupts = <1 2>;
>  		pd-gpio = <&gpio0 4 0>;
>  		adi,dsi-lanes = <4>;
> +		#sound-dai-cells = <0>;
> +
> +		ports {
> +			#address-cells = <1>;
> +			#size-cells = <0>;
> +			port@0 {
> +				adv7533_in: endpoint {
> +					remote-endpoint = <&dsi_out0>;
> +				};
> +			};
> +			port@2 {
> +				reg = <2>;
> +				codec_endpoint: endpoint {
> +					remote-endpoint = <&i2s0_cpu_endpoint>;
> +				};
> +			};
> +		};
> +	};
> +};
>  
> -		port {
> -			adv7533_in: endpoint {
> -				remote-endpoint = <&dsi_out0>;
> +&i2s0 {
> +
> +	ports {
> +		i2s0_port0: port@0 {
> +			i2s0_cpu_endpoint: endpoint {
> +				remote-endpoint = <&codec_endpoint>;
> +				dai-format = "i2s";
>  			};
>  		};
>  	};
> diff --git a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/hisilicon/hi6220.dtsi b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/hisilicon/hi6220.dtsi
> index 5013e4b..f2e218c 100644
> --- a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/hisilicon/hi6220.dtsi
> +++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/hisilicon/hi6220.dtsi
> @@ -332,6 +332,19 @@
>  			status = "disabled";
>  		};
>  
> +		dma0: dma@f7370000 {
> +			compatible = "hisilicon,k3-dma-1.0";
> +			reg = <0x0 0xf7370000 0x0 0x1000>;
> +			#dma-cells = <1>;
> +			dma-channels = <15>;
> +			dma-requests = <32>;
> +			interrupts = <0 84 4>;
> +			clocks = <&sys_ctrl HI6220_EDMAC_ACLK>;
> +			dma-no-cci;
> +			dma-type = "hi6220_dma";
> +			status = "ok";
> +		};
> +
>  		dual_timer0: timer@f8008000 {
>  			compatible = "arm,sp804", "arm,primecell";
>  			reg = <0x0 0xf8008000 0x0 0x1000>;
> @@ -805,6 +818,19 @@
>  			#thermal-sensor-cells = <1>;
>  		};
>  
> +		i2s0: i2s@f7118000{
> +			compatible = "hisilicon,hi6210-i2s";
> +			reg = <0x0 0xf7118000 0x0 0x8000>; /* i2s unit */
> +			interrupts = <GIC_SPI 123 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>; /* 155 "DigACodec_intr"-32 */
> +			clocks = <&sys_ctrl HI6220_DACODEC_PCLK>,
> +				 <&sys_ctrl HI6220_BBPPLL0_DIV>;
> +			clock-names = "dacodec", "i2s-base";
> +			dmas = <&dma0 15 &dma0 14>;
> +			dma-names = "rx", "tx";
> +			hisilicon,sysctrl-syscon = <&sys_ctrl>;
> +			#sound-dai-cells = <1>;
> +		};
> +
>  		thermal-zones {
>  
>  			cls0: cls0 {
>
